排除以注释开头的行的实用命令技巧

晚上好,我是佐藤,我的桌面杂物越多,我的工作量就越大。

工作中我经常需要阅读和研究各种配置文件和代码。

这些评论真烦人!

你有没有想过这个问题(尤其是在做研究的时候)?

在这种情况下,使用此别名可以简化操作!

别名ggrep='grep -v -e "^\s*#" -e "^\s*$"'

  • 从行首开始#
  • 如果行首有空格,
  • 仅换行

具有以下三种模式的线条将被排除在外。

不支持除 # 以外的注释,因此请根据您要排除的注释字符重新编写注释。

顺便一提

在撰写本文的过程中,


第一次了解到
grep代表正则表达式打印( Globally

别名命名为 ggrep,仅仅是因为已经有了名为 egrep 和 fgrep 的命令,所以它排在后面。

如果你喜欢,请将其添加到你的 .bashrc 文件的末尾。

如果您觉得这篇文章有用,请点击【点赞】!
0
加载中...
0票,平均分:0.00/10
951
X Facebook Hatena书签 口袋

这篇文章的作者

关于作者

佐藤圣坚

我的第六感在关键时刻很敏锐,但我本质上是个老派的工程师。我
目前在加拿大办公室工作。